Output ec84d10273a81b0a4983ed16132645d1ca322ececab9f47f823b2bf811bb6b1e:2

value
33405822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a56120b5189368c8d441c69b7620b4a2430a32a4 OP_EQUAL
address
MNyc5dvqsQkD1mehp3uXSQLXUfQTYSqkcJ
transaction
ec84d10273a81b0a4983ed16132645d1ca322ececab9f47f823b2bf811bb6b1e
spent
true